One woman is dead and a man is in life-threatening condition following a three-vehicle crash in Ajax on Wednesday.

Durham Regional Police say the crash happened near the intersection of Kingston Road West and Elizabeth Street, according to a post on social media around 1:30 p.m.

A woman has been pronounced dead following the collision while a man was rushed to hospital with life-threatening injuries.

Police have closed the intersection at Kingston Road West and Elizabeth Street while an investigation is underway.

Drivers are being asked to avoid the area and find alternate routes if possible.

Anyone with information about this incident can contact Durham Regional Police at 905-579-1520.
